MOGU vs AMZN Comparison May 2026

MOGU plays a significant role within the Consumer Cyclical sector. Its performance reflects broader market trends and attracts considerable investor interest.

Comparing market capitalization, MOGU stands at 18M. In comparison, AMZN has a market cap of 2.8T. Regarding current trading prices, MOGU is priced at $2.12, while AMZN trades at $264.14.

To assess relative profitability and valuation, we examine the Return on Equity (ROE) and Price-to-Earnings (P/E) ratios.

MOGU currently has a P/E ratio of 4.82, whereas AMZN's P/E ratio is 31.63. In terms of profitability, MOGU's ROE is -0.07%, compared to AMZN's ROE of +0.23%.
